The House voted unanimously to increase Secret Service protections for presidential candidates, giving them the same level of security as sitting presidents while traveling on the campaign trail.  Lawmakers passed a resolution in a 405-0 vote on Friday that would enhance protections for former President Donald Trump and Vice President Kamala Harris with rare, widespread […]

First lady Jill Biden is opening up about how she feels about her husband, President Joe Biden, preparing for his final days in public life. She told NBC News that they are “totally at peace” with his decision to drop out of the presidential race, though there have been reports that the couple doesn’t feel […]

New York magazine placed Washington correspondent Olivia Nuzzi on leave after allegedly revealing a “personal relationship” with a “former subject relevant to the 2024 campaign,” the magazine announced Thursday. CNN reported that the person Nuzzi had a relationship with was former independent presidential candidate Robert F. Kennedy Jr., something his spokesperson denied to the outlet, […]

Reps. Garret Graves (R-LA) and Abigail Spanberger (D-VA) overcame resistance from leadership to move legislation through Congress that repeals two long-standing programs affecting Social Security benefits for recipients across the country. The bipartisan Social Security Fairness Act earned the support of 128 members of Congress on Thursday, enabling it to be brought to the House […]
